Top reasons to visit Janes Island State Park

  • Scenic Water Trails: Janes Island State Park features picturesque water trails perfect for kayaking and canoeing, allowing visitors to explore its stunning natural beauty.
  • Campsite Options: The park offers various camping experiences, from island cabins to backcountry sites, ensuring a unique outdoor adventure.
  • Recreational Facilities: Enjoy a range of recreational activities, including a golf course, picnic areas, and a boardwalk for leisurely strolls.
  • Tranquil Environment: The serene setting of the park makes it ideal for relaxation and family gatherings amidst nature.
  • Close to Charming Neighbourhoods: The park’s proximity to quaint local areas allows for exploration of Maryland's culture and charm.

Where to stay near Janes Island State Park

Janes Island State Park offers a perfect blend of outdoor adventure and serene relaxation. Explore its picturesque water trails, accessible beaches, and inviting island campgrounds. The park's picnic tables provide an ideal setting for family-friendly gatherings amidst stunning scenery. Nearby, you can enjoy a tranquil atmosphere, making it a splendid choice for those seeking a secluded getaway while still being close to charming neighbourhoods. Embrace the beauty of Maryland's outdoors in this delightful destination.

  • Crisfield: Nestled along the scenic shores of the Chesapeake Bay, Crisfield is a charming city that serves as the gateway to Janes Island State Park. Known for its rich maritime heritage, visitors flock to Crisfield for outdoor adventures and family-friendly experiences. The city's boardwalk and recreational areas offer a perfect backdrop for leisurely strolls and picnics. Popular activities include golfing and exploring the local marina, while nearby beaches provide sun-soaked relaxation. As you wander through this picturesque locale, don’t miss the opportunity to savour fresh seafood at local eateries, making for a delightful culinary experience.

Find the best attractions near Janes Island State Park

Janes Island State Park offers a delightful blend of outdoor activities and scenic beauty, perfect for families and nature enthusiasts alike. Visitors can explore the stunning islands, enjoy the marina, and relax in the park’s serene environment. Popular options include staying in island state park cabins or utilising backcountry campsites, ensuring a memorable experience amidst Maryland's natural charm.

  • Crisfield City Dock: Experience the vibrant atmosphere of Crisfield City Dock, a bustling marina offering stunning views and a range of water-based activities. With its adventurous beach vibes, it's the perfect spot for kayaking, fishing, or simply enjoying the coastal scenery.
  • J. Millard Tawes Museum: Immerse yourself in local heritage at the J. Millard Tawes Museum, where you can explore exhibits showcasing the rich culture and history of the area. This museum offers a fascinating glimpse into the past, making it a must-visit for history enthusiasts.
  • Wellington Beach and Park: Enjoy a family-friendly day out at Wellington Beach and Park, an eco-conscious retreat just 1.6km from Janes Island State Park. With recreational areas and beautiful sandy shores, it's ideal for picnics, nature walks, and relaxation.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Janes Island State Park

Accessing Janes Island State Park is convenient via several major airports. Salisbury-Ocean City Wicomico Regional Airport (SBY) is situated 46.7km away, with nearby hotels such as the 3-star Courtyard by Marriott Salisbury, located 9.7km from the airport, and the La Quinta Inn & Suites by Wyndham Salisbury, just 6.4km away. Ocean City Municipal Airport (OCE) is 72.4km from the park, featuring hotels like the 4-star Hilton Ocean City Oceanfront Suites, 6.4km away. Finally, Sussex County Airport (GED) is 56.4km from the park, with options including the avid hotel Millsboro Georgetown South, 14.5km from the airport. Each hotel provides easy access to the respective airports.
